Output 705c51a2b62a27b754ddb29438902d4ef6376fcbd00455cb3946400de7186ba7:0

value
76861853
script pubkey
OP_HASH160 OP_PUSHBYTES_20 142b80e18762168ef252b2a3ec3cfe7c1a331678 OP_EQUAL
address
33XfZ3ziATB5CEs3rpMnd6ga8TvJTG9ycE
transaction
705c51a2b62a27b754ddb29438902d4ef6376fcbd00455cb3946400de7186ba7
spent
true